Under the SEC Whistleblower Program, eligible whistleblowers can potentially recover a reward equal to 10%â30% of the amount of any monetary sanctions collected that exceed $1 million in actions brought by the SEC and related actions brought by other regulatory and law enforcement authorities. The results suggest that personality, in the form of high extraversion and dominance and low agreeableness, do play a role as antecedents of whistleblowing. ... Among personality traits, people who are high in extraversion are more likely to blow the whistle[18].Finally,peoplewitha proactivepersonality, who seekto inï¬uence and controltheir environment,are less susceptible to situational inï¬uences and appear more likely to engage in whistleblowing [18â20]. Whistleblowers often come from the periphery of an organization; their outsider status can shield them from groupthink and pressure to conform. Looking at the data, the majority of whistleblowers are actively engaged, high-performing employees, most in prominent positions, supervisors or managers, with years of loyalty to the company ( 2 ). Miethe (1999) points out that while some whistleblowers can be seen as altruistic, selfless individuals who take action at âextraordinary personal costâ others can best be described as âselfish and egotisticalâ (often described as âsnitchesâ, âratsâ, âmolesâ, âfinksâ and âblabbermouthsâ.
